Output dbde75229f294e3818353bbfb22835f194ec4b140898f4bb51550101e5c54af7:86

value
43338236
script pubkey
OP_0 OP_PUSHBYTES_20 ac1524aa2bfd8631cc91b8c61475ab147afbb4c4
address
bc1q4s2jf23tlkrrrny3hrrpgadtz3a0hdxy8nz6d2
transaction
dbde75229f294e3818353bbfb22835f194ec4b140898f4bb51550101e5c54af7